Love: The Healing Force at the Core of Bliss’s Poetry
At the heart of Robert E. Bliss’s poetry lies love — not just the romantic kind, but the broader, more profound love that encompasses self-acceptance, compassion, and human connection. The poem Love is This exemplifies how Bliss explores the concept of love in all its forms. The verses are tender and heartfelt, depicting love as an omnipresent force that nurtures, heals, and gives life meaning:
“Love is the sun on your face
Wind in your hair
Waiting lips to taste
Those moments we share”
In these words, Bliss paints a picture of love that is natural, unassuming, and ever-present. Love is not confined to grand gestures or dramatic declarations but is found in the simplicity of everyday moments. For those who may be struggling with feelings of loneliness or heartbreak, Love is This reminds us that love exists in the quiet spaces of life, in the things we often overlook. It offers comfort by suggesting that love is not something we must chase or grasp for; it’s already there, waiting for us to recognize it.
The idea that love is always accessible recurs throughout Bliss Poetry. Whether it’s the yearning for love in I Am Sailing, where the poet expresses a deep longing to return to a beloved, or the delicate tenderness in Waiting, Bliss’s words remind us that love, though sometimes distant, is always within reach. His portrayal of love is both a source of strength and a gentle invitation for healing.
Loss: Finding Strength in Vulnerability
As much as Bliss’s poetry celebrates love, it also takes us into the realm of loss—a topic that resonates deeply with many. Loss is an inevitable part of the human experience, whether it’s the death of a loved one, the end of a relationship, or the loss of a dream. Bliss Poetry doesn’t shy away from these heavy emotions. Instead, it offers readers a safe space to confront them, grieve, and ultimately heal.
In Were You There, Bliss reflects on the painful realities of war and loss, using vivid imagery to capture the anguish and sorrow of a soldier’s journey. The poem speaks not just to those who have experienced war, but also to anyone who has lost someone—a friend, a family member, or even a part of themselves. The poem’s repetitive questioning, “Were you there?”, evokes a sense of emptiness and longing, but it also speaks to the resilience of the human spirit:
“Were you there when he went off to war?
Holding his fate in his ancestor’s hands
Knowing little of life, but wanting much more
And sure in his youth, he could be a man”
The vulnerability in these lines opens the door for empathy and understanding. Bliss doesn’t simply recount a story of loss; he invites the reader to experience it with him. This shared emotional experience fosters a sense of connection and belonging—an essential part of the healing process. By acknowledging the pain, Bliss allows readers to begin their own journey toward emotional release and recovery.
Self-Discovery: The Path to Healing
Beyond love and loss, Bliss Poetry delves into the theme of self-discovery. The poet reflects on his own internal struggles and growth, and through his vulnerability, he guides others to explore their own path toward healing. In poems such as A Simple Life and The Space Inside, Bliss explores the importance of introspection and self-awareness. These poems encourage readers to look within themselves for the answers they seek, to embrace their imperfections, and to find strength in their own identity.
A Simple Life offers a powerful perspective on the value of simplicity and the importance of letting go of societal expectations. Bliss rejects the pursuit of material wealth and superficial status, instead opting for a life grounded in love and authenticity:
“I don’t care what shoe I wear
Nor the color of my shirt
There’s some of me to share
As loneliness looks round and flirts”
In these lines, Bliss highlights the freedom that comes from shedding external pressures and embracing a life true to oneself. For readers who may feel trapped by the weight of external validation or expectations, this poem offers a reminder that true peace comes from within, and healing begins when we allow ourselves to be.
Similarly, The Space Inside explores the idea of emotional space and personal growth. It speaks to the journey of finding peace within oneself, even in the midst of turmoil:
“Hold the stars inside yourself
Save the pieces when pieces disappear.”
This line speaks directly to those who are struggling with the fragmentation of their identity or emotions. It reminds us that, even in moments of disarray, we possess the inner strength to heal and rebuild. The imagery of holding stars inside oneself symbolizes the light and potential that reside within, even when external circumstances make it difficult to see.
